Outage hits AI’s check-ins at many airports, flights delayed

Mumbai: Air India on Tuesday evening informed its passengers about significant delays across its network after a third-party system disruption affected check-in operations at multiple airports.
In a statement posted on X, the airline said the outage had led to longer processing times at airports. Airport teams were “working diligently to ensure a smooth check-in experience”, but some flights may continue to face delays until the system is fully restored, the airline said.
